Output 6175472d827840927837afa8ec272239391309a40115d20c05706c76d7990436:20

value
3684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bfce4324c5641153eef24eb80f2486b00156aab006361d3dc7bf404f2f345c4a
address
bc1phl8yxfx9vsg48mhjf6uq7fyxkqq4d24sqcmp60w8haqy7te5t39qrtj90q
transaction
6175472d827840927837afa8ec272239391309a40115d20c05706c76d7990436
spent
true